About
Pantamuzik started back in 1999 as an electronic music label. It was founded by Humberto Polar with the purpose of releasing latin american artists that work with the aesthetics of techno and house but are rooted on the vast creative insights of afro-latin music. The first Pantamuzik editions were launched in Peru and Colombia and were mostly DJ mixes in CD format, featuring tracks by colombian, chilean, peruvian, argentinean and mexican producers. "Delahouse" Vol. 1 and 2 (mixed by Polar in 2001) were followed by "Electrodaca", "Corte Unisex" and "Musica de Panta" compilations.
From 2004 Pantamuzik settled in Mexico City and started releasing digitally, a move that allowed them to expand their audience to Europe. They signed with prestigious underground latinamerican musicians and DJs such as Miguel Toro (Venezuela/Berlin), Israel Vich (Peru), Nu (Peru/Berlin), Signal Deluxe (Mexico), Mild Bang, Ricardo Abeyllera and Cindy Freeman (Mexico), Julian Brody (Los Angeles/Mexico), Razz (Argentina) and Monopolar (Peru/Colombia). After 10 years, Pantamuzik continues to support new artists and is constantly releasing and taking their artists on tour through the world. Some of the most interesting artists from the european scene have joined the label on fantastic remix work, such as M.In, Sierra Sam & Marcus Vector, Jay Haze, Argenis Brito and Camea.
